Historic Sumatran Coffee Heritage
Coffee production in Sumatra began in the 18th century under colonial domination:

Lake Toba Region Excellence
Most of the coffee is produced around the Lake Toba region, in the subregions of Lintong, Nihuta, Sumbul, and Takengon:

Mandheling Coffee Tradition
Sumatrans are sold as Mandheling, which is simply the Indonesian ethnic group that is most involved in coffee production:

Bold Dry-Processing Excellence
Dry-processed Sumatran coffees are the boldest of the Indonesian coffee-growing world:

Brewing Recommendations
For the best women-produced coffee experience:
-
Grind size - Medium-coarse for French press, medium for drip
-
Water temperature - 195-205°F
-
Brew ratio - 1:15 to 1:17
-
Extraction time - 4-6 minutes for optimal cedar and chocolate notes
-
Fresh grinding - Grind just before brewing
